The tender for the “innovative” and “disruptive” naval vessel was abandoned

The tender for the construction of a new naval ship, called “multipurpose” or “multipurpose”, was discontinued, a pioneer naval platform able to design multiple capabilities, mainly robotics and unmanned systems (aerial, land and submarine drones).

“The tender limited by pre-qualification for the “multi-purpose” vessel began on June 20, 2022. Two candidates were proposed for the qualification phase, one of which was qualified but did not submit a proposal,” confirmed to the DN Official source of the Office of the Chief of Staff of the Navy (CEMA).

This was one of the “disruptive” and “innovative” projects that CEMA Admiral Gouveia and Melo was launched, using the resources available for these capabilities from the Recovery and Resilience Plan (PRR). Funding of EUR 100 million has been approved for this project.

But the navy does not give up🇧🇷 According to the spokesperson mentioned above, “the project has considered this possible scenario and therefore legal options are foreseen and will be explored to continue this important project with a view to its implementation”.

In a recent presentation of this ship at the Confraria Marítima / Liga Naval Portuguesa, the Director of Ships of the Armada, Vice Admiral Jorge Pires, had classified this project as “very ambitious, one of the most structuring and challenging in the Navy”, revealing at the time that the proposal was expected from the only candidate who qualified.

It is a scientific ship, which will be a kind of base on the high seas, equipped with scientific laboratories, accommodation for 90 people permanently and another 100 if necessary, for example in an emergency evacuation situation, ramps for vehicle entry and exit, helipad, landing strips for aerial drones, a bay for submarine drones and speedboatsseveral cranes for lifting research equipment – a “capacity projection platform”, as Jorge Pires explained.

The Navy states that this “ship will contribute to the knowledge, conservation and sustainable exploration of the oceanfor direct support to the population in response to crises and for the strengthening the country’s operational and scientific capacityin particular for mapping and protecting living and non-living resources, but also for the maritime surveillance and surveillance, marine search and rescue and response to maritime casualtieswho usually resort to unmanned aerial vehicles (VENT) to perform their tasks.

In its candidacy for the PRR, the Navy underlined that “this ship, designed under a new control concept, has no military requirements and is not armed🇧🇷 Its main functions are environmental monitoring, namely combating marine pollution, monitoring fisheries, conserving resources, developing knowledge and research in hydrographic and scientific fields”.

According to that text, “all of its drones are weaponless and the sensors used serve to monitor, monitor and control maritime spaces under national jurisdiction”.

The ship, it was pointed out, “will still serve the possible transport and evacuation of civilians when necessary. With the concept of dual use, and being a ship technologically innovative and disruptivewill make it possible to test technological solutions in the field of robotics, contributing to the development of national technology”.

In the aforementioned presentation, the Director of Ships assured that this project is a “incentive for the entire community connected to the sea, industry and academia”, with “very interesting challenges and huge opportunities”, noting that the Navy’s intention was “to involve national industry as much as possible”. .
